With manicured lawns dotted in the spring with cherry blossom petals, there is a house with a bay window, home fr 70 years to a Professor of Engineering, the longest tenured professor at Brooklyn Polytechnic Institute. Welcome to 119 80th Street, a beautifully preserved, pre-war, single-family home 18' by 56' on a 26' by 118' lot. Central to the living room is a working fireplace, accented by custom built shelves. Beyond the living room is a formal dining room, which leads to an eat in kitchen. Three bedrooms, on the second floor, plus a home office or bonus room on the first, make this a forever home.
Off the primary bedroom is an expansive terrace. Two g ems make this space truly special: a finished basement with wood paneling, an additional fireplace, full bathroom, separate laundry room with linen closet and many closets for storage and original wood floors on the first and second floors.Next to a tree in the backyard is a private driveway and garage. A nine-foot attic can be transformed into an ample living space. Close to the park, subway and the waterfront, located in prime Bay Ridge, a neighborhood that is a microcosm of Contemporary York City's culture and cuisine, make this the best of many worlds, the ideal suburban home in the city.
